Pop/Review C'batch - Next Time (I Won’t Be Falling)
Stephen H. Cumberbatch, a/k/a C'batch, is a composer, author, producer, and musician (guitarist) from White Plains, New York, United States. He is also a keyboard, synthesizer, and sampler programmer who has worked in association with many music professionals. Stephen proudly stands as a distinguished member of ASCAP.
“Next Time (I Won’t Be Falling)” by C’batch is a polished and emotionally layered EP that seamlessly blends Smooth Jazz, Contemporary R&B, and Euro-Pop into a cohesive late-night listening experience. Centered around themes of romantic relapse and emotional contradiction, the project captures the push-and-pull of wanting to move on while still being drawn back into familiar patterns.
From the opening moments, C’batch establishes a mood of understated elegance. The production is lush yet restrained, built on warm synth textures, gentle grooves, and a rhythmic flow that feels both hypnotic and fluid. This sonic palette allows the emotional core of the project to breathe, creating space for reflection without losing its sense of movement.
Vocally, C’batch delivers with a velvety smoothness that enhances the EP’s intimate tone. There’s a quiet vulnerability in the performance, as if each line is part of an internal dialogue rather than a grand declaration. This subtle approach makes the emotional tension feel more authentic, particularly in moments where the lyrics wrestle with self-awareness and unresolved attachment.
One of the standout aspects of the EP is its versatility. Alongside the vocal tracks, the cinematic interpretations of the title song offer a glimpse into a broader artistic vision. These instrumental reworks expand the emotional landscape, hinting at the more expansive, filmic direction of the upcoming “The Vault 4 – Cinematic” project.
Ultimately, “Next Time (I Won’t Be Falling)” is a refined and immersive release that balances introspection with groove. It’s equally suited for solitary reflection and late-night drives, showcasing C’batch’s ability to craft music that is both emotionally resonant and sonically sophisticated.
